Reserve Status OptionsReserve Status Options

• Merchant Marine Individual Ready Reserve Group (MMIRRG)Merchant Marine Individual Ready Reserve Group (MMIRRG): IRR. : IRR. But considered in an active status. About 80% of SSO’s are But considered in an active status. About 80% of SSO’s are members of this Group. MMIRRGs are essentially “free agents” and members of this Group. MMIRRGs are essentially “free agents” and can pick and choose their ADT’s. can pick and choose their ADT’s.

• Select Reserve (SELRES):Select Reserve (SELRES): Are organized units of the Navy Reserve. Are organized units of the Navy Reserve. They drill once per month and usually perform AT as a unit. Officers They drill once per month and usually perform AT as a unit. Officers assigned to these units hold billets and generally incur an obligation assigned to these units hold billets and generally incur an obligation as a drilling reservist. They earn pay and accumulate points for their as a drilling reservist. They earn pay and accumulate points for their drills and are also eligible for greater benefits. Affiliation to the drills and are also eligible for greater benefits. Affiliation to the SELRES can only be done through a recruiter and ascension is SELRES can only be done through a recruiter and ascension is based on the needs of the service. About 10% of SSOs are members based on the needs of the service. About 10% of SSOs are members of SELRES units. of SELRES units.

• Volunteer Training Unit (VTU):Volunteer Training Unit (VTU): Is similar to a SELRES unit, as you Is similar to a SELRES unit, as you earn points for drilling however, there is no monetary compensation earn points for drilling however, there is no monetary compensation for drills, and VTUs don’t actively prepare to mobilize in the manner for drills, and VTUs don’t actively prepare to mobilize in the manner which a SELRES does. As a VTU member, your ADT’s are not funded which a SELRES does. As a VTU member, your ADT’s are not funded by the MMR Program Office. Conversely you are not guaranteed by the MMR Program Office. Conversely you are not guaranteed MMIRRG ADT funds. Roughly 10% of SSO’s are VTU members. MMIRRG ADT funds. Roughly 10% of SSO’s are VTU members.

The Point SystemThe Point System

• All Reserve participation is recognized by the issuance of points. Points All Reserve participation is recognized by the issuance of points. Points accumulation is crucial for remaining in good standing, and ultimately being accumulation is crucial for remaining in good standing, and ultimately being able to retire.able to retire.

• You MUST attain 27 points per year to remain in the Reserves. You MUST attain 27 points per year to remain in the Reserves.

• To achieve a “Qualifying Year” towards retirement you must attain at least 50 To achieve a “Qualifying Year” towards retirement you must attain at least 50 points in your anniversary year; Points CANNOT be rolled over between yearspoints in your anniversary year; Points CANNOT be rolled over between years

• You must have at least 20 Good years to retire and earn a pensionYou must have at least 20 Good years to retire and earn a pension

• Points can be earned in a number of ways:Points can be earned in a number of ways:-15 points are gratuitous for Reserve Membership-15 points are gratuitous for Reserve Membership-1 point is awarded for every day of Active Duty served-1 point is awarded for every day of Active Duty served-1 point is awarded for every 4 hours served while in a drilling status (SELRES, VTU,IDT) -1 point is awarded for every 4 hours served while in a drilling status (SELRES, VTU,IDT) -Correspondence courses offered on NKO and thru NETC-Correspondence courses offered on NKO and thru NETC-35 Points are awarded for a license renewal or upgrade with a STCW endorsement. Your -35 Points are awarded for a license renewal or upgrade with a STCW endorsement. Your

initial license COUNTS for points, thus your first year is automatically a good year!initial license COUNTS for points, thus your first year is automatically a good year!-1 point is awarded for every 4 hours of an STCW course, up to 5 points can be awarded -1 point is awarded for every 4 hours of an STCW course, up to 5 points can be awarded

for Non-STCW courses per yearfor Non-STCW courses per year

All Courses are awarded on the DATE which the course certificate indicates, NOT All Courses are awarded on the DATE which the course certificate indicates, NOT when it is submitted to NPC or the Program Office when it is submitted to NPC or the Program Office
